Разработчик баз данных создаёт надёжные системы хранения информации, оптимизирует запросы, настраивает резервное копирование и защищает данные от потерь и взломов. От его работы зависит стабильность банков, маркетплейсов, медицинских учреждений и государственных сервисов. Рассказываем, что нужно сделать, если вы хотите стать разработчиком баз данных, какое образовательное учреждение закончить и какие перспективы ждут профессию в будущем.
Кто такой разработчик баз данных
Разработчик баз данных — это IT-специалист, который проектирует, создаёт и поддерживает базы данных для сайтов, приложений и внутренних систем компании. Его задача — настроить базу данных так, чтобы приложение быстро работало, а нужная информация не терялась и не искажалась.
Разработчики трудятся в IT-компаниях и банках, интернет-сервисах и логистике, медицине и образовании, промышленности, телекоммуникациях и госсекторе.
Практикующий специалист решает ряд задач:
- продумывает структуру базы данных;
- создаёт таблицы, связи и ограничения;
- пишет SQL-запросы;
- настраивает индексы;
- проверяет производительность;
- исправляет ошибки.
Он следит за целостностью данных, участвует в резервном копировании, помогает защитить информацию от утечек, работает с аналитиками, backend-разработчиками и администраторами.
Для этой профессии нужны знания и навыки:
- владение SQL;
- умение проектировать и моделировать данные;
- работа с реляционными базами данных;
- написание и оптимизация запросов;
- настройка индексов, связей, ключей и ограничений;
- понимание нормализации данных;
- поиск и устранение причин сбоев и ошибок в базе;
- знание принципов резервного копирования и восстановления данных;
- понимание основ информационной безопасности и разграничения доступа;
- чтение технической документации, работа в команде с другими разработчиками.
В работе специалист использует PostgreSQL и MySQL, Microsoft SQL Server и Oracle, MongoDB и ER-диаграммы, UML для проектирования структуры базы и системы контроля версий, например Git. Из языков нужно знать SQL, Python, Java, C#, PHP или JavaScript.

Какими качествами должен обладать специалист
Для этой работы важны не только профессиональные знания, но и личные качества:
- Аналитический склад ума: умение видеть логику и закономерности в данных.
- Внимательность: ошибка в типе поля, связи между таблицами или SQL-запросе может сломать часть системы или исказить информацию.
- Педантичность: ответственное отношение к структуре данных, аккуратность, профилактика ошибок.
- Усидчивость и терпение: способность долго работать над сложными задачами.
- Обучаемость: быстрая адаптация к новым технологиям, трендам и требованиям.
- Коммуникабельность: умение взаимодействовать с командой разработчиков и аналитиков.
Насколько востребованы специалисты сейчас
Спрос на профессию сохраняется по нескольким причинам:
- информации становится больше, и старые инструменты не справляются с нагрузкой;
- компаниям нужны базы данных для сайтов, приложений и рабочих программ, а значит, нужны специалисты, которые умеют их создавать и поддерживать;
- растёт рынок систем управления базами данных (СУБД) и ужесточаются стандарты безопасности, поэтому работодателям требуются специалисты, которые отвечают за стабильную работу всей системы.

Как стать разработчиком баз данных
Стать разработчиком можно двумя способами. Первый — получить профильное IT-образование в колледже или вузе.
Второй — пройти офлайн- или онлайн-курсы на базе среднего профессионального или высшего образования. Поступить могут и студенты, не завершившие основное обучение.
Какие предметы сдавать
На программы СПО, связанные с IT и базами данных, принимают по конкурсу аттестатов после 9 или 11 класса. Рейтинг строится по среднему баллу: чем он выше, тем больше шансов на зачисление.
Для поступления в вуз нужно сдать ЕГЭ по русскому языку и профильной математике. Третий предмет устанавливает университет: информатика, физика или иностранный язык. Точный список нужно смотреть на сайте вуза.
На курсы повышения квалификации или профессиональной переподготовки принимают тех, у кого уже есть диплом вуза или колледжа, а также действующих студентов. Для онлайн-курсов единых требований нет — условия устанавливает сама школа.
Куда поступать
Среднее профессиональное образование:
- «Разработка и управление программным обеспечением», «Информационные системы и программирование (тестировщик ПО)» в Колледже «Синергия».
- «Разработка и управление программным обеспечением» в IT-колледже Российского нового университета (IT-колледж РосНОУ).
- «Разработка и управление программным обеспечением», «Интеграция решений с применением технологий искусственного интеллекта» в Колледже Архитектуры, Дизайна и Реинжиниринга № 26 (26 КАДР).
- «Разработка и управление программным обеспечением», «Интеграция решений с применением технологий искусственного интеллекта» в Ставропольском многопрофильном колледже (СМК).
- «Разработка и управление программным обеспечением» в Московском индустриальном колледже (МИК).
Высшее образование:
- «Разработка программного обеспечения (Full-stack разработка)» в Университете «Синергия».
- «Информационные системы и базы данных» в Санкт-Петербургском политехническом университете Петра Великого (СПБПУ).
- «Информационные системы и базы данных» в Московском государственном психолого-педагогическом университете (МГППУ).
- «Инженерия данных» в Московском техническом университете связи и информатики (МТУСИ).
- «Прикладные информационные системы в экономике и финансах», «Прикладное машинное обучение», «Прикладные информационные системы в экономике и финансах. Инженерия данных» в Финансовом университете при Правительстве Российской Федерации (Финансовый университет).
Курсы:
- «Безопасность операционных систем и баз данных» от Университета «Синергия».
- «Разработчик баз данных» от Онлайн-университета профессий Eduson Academy.
- «Разработчик баз данных» от Бауманского учебного центра «Специалист».
- «Разработчик баз данных PostgreSQL» от Центра авторизованного обучения информационным технологиям (ЦАО ИТ).
- «Разработчик баз данных» от Нового бизнес университета (НБУ).
- «Специалист по работе с базами данных» от Высшей инженерной школы Санкт-Петербургского политехнического университета Петра Великого (ВИШ СПбПУ).
С чего начать профессиональный путь
После колледжа или вуза выпускник обычно начинает с позиции стажёра или junior-разработчика. Такие специалисты чаще всего нужны в продуктовых IT-компаниях, банках, интернет-сервисах, ретейле, логистике и крупных компаниях со своими внутренними системами. На старте им дают понятные задачи: писать SQL-запросы, исправлять ошибки и поддерживать готовую базу.
Далее разработчик переходит на уровень middle. Специалист сам решает рабочие задачи, оптимизирует запросы, проектирует части базы и понимает, как система ведёт себя при критической нагрузке. С ростом навыков и компетенций разработчик переходит на уровень senior. Он не просто пишет код, а принимает важные технические решения, отвечает за сложные участки системы и помогает младшим коллегам.
Карьерный трек
Сколько зарабатывают разработчики баз данных
Зарплата разработчика зависит от профессионального уровня специалиста, региона работы и сложности задач. Один работает с типовой внутренней системой, другой — с большой нагруженной базой, от которой зависит весь сервис, и доход у них будет разный.
В среднем по России разработчик зарабатывает около 190 тыс. рублей в месяц, при этом в крупных компаниях и в Москве зарплаты обычно выше.
Что ждёт профессию в будущем
Будущее профессии разработчика баз данных определяется масштабными изменениями на рынке облачных баз данных и DBaaS.
- Искусственный интеллект возьмёт на себя рутинные задачи: оптимизацию запросов, прогнозирование нагрузки и выявление угроз безопасности. Разработчики перестанут тратить время на ручную настройку производительности и сосредоточатся на постановке задач для ИИ‑ассистентов, проверке их решений и обучении моделей под специфику данных компании.
- Бессерверные и cloud‑native архитектуры станут отраслевым стандартом. Облачные провайдеры предложат полностью управляемые СУБД, где ресурсы выделяются автоматически, а резервное копирование выполняется без участия человека. Разработчикам не придётся следить за оборудованием. Вместо этого они будут проектировать логику приложений, контролировать затраты на облачные ресурсы и интегрировать базы данных с другими сервисами.
- Большинство проектов перейдут на гибридные и мультимодельные базы данных, объединяющие реляционные таблицы, векторные индексы, графовые структуры и документные хранилища. Разработчикам нужно будет выбирать оптимальное хранение для каждого типа данных и обеспечивать их работоспособность в единой системе.
- Развитие IoT и 5G ускорит распространение edge‑вычислений. Данные будут обрабатываться не в центральном облаке, а на периферийных устройствах. Разработчикам придётся проектировать системы с учётом низкой задержки, нестабильной связи и необходимости синхронизировать информацию между тысячами узлов. Они научатся распределять нагрузку между edge‑устройствами и облаком, кэшировать критически важные данные локально и обеспечивать целостность при разрывах соединения.
- В долгосрочной перспективе начнут появляться первые гибридные квантовые решения. Хотя массовый переход на квантовые вычисления займёт много времени, разработчикам уже через десять лет потребуется понимать принципы квантовых алгоритмов и работать с квантово‑устойчивыми методами шифрования.
Когда отмечают профессиональные праздники
Разработчики отмечают профессиональный праздник в 256-й день года. Обычно это 13 сентября, но если в году есть 29 февраля (високосный год), то праздник переносится на 12 сентября.
Число 256 выбрали не случайно. Для IT это ключевое значение: именно столько разных комбинаций данных можно уместить в одном байте.
В России этот день стал официальным государственным праздником в 2009 году.








